Determining What: Defining Your Goals and Objectives

Once you know who you are targeting, it's time to define what you want to achieve. Establishing clear goals and objectives provides a roadmap for your growth strategy.

  • Set SMART goals: Ensure your goals are Specific, Measurable, Achievable, Relevant, and Time-bound.
  • Prioritize goals: Allocate resources wisely by identifying the most important and achievable goals first.
  • Monitor progress regularly: Track your progress towards your goals using key performance indicators (KPIs) and adjust your strategies as needed.

Optimizing When: Timing Your Strategies for Maximum Impact

The timing of your initiatives can significantly impact their effectiveness. When should you launch new products, implement marketing campaigns, or make strategic decisions?

  • Consider seasonality: Analyze historical data and industry trends to identify periods of high demand or activity.
  • Capitalize on current events: Leverage news, industry changes, or social trends to align your messaging and offerings with what's top of mind for your audience.
  • Avoid oversaturation: Plan your campaigns carefully to avoid overwhelming your target market with too much information in a short period.

Uncovering Why: Understanding Motivations and Decision-Making Processes

Motivations and decision-making processes drive human behavior and influence consumer purchases. Why do people buy your products or services? What factors influence their choices?

  • Conduct customer surveys: Ask open-ended questions to understand customer motivations, pain points, and decision-making criteria.
  • Analyze customer reviews and testimonials: Identify patterns and themes in customer feedback to uncover common reasons for purchase or satisfaction.
  • Use social media monitoring: Monitor online conversations and discussions to gauge customer sentiment and identify pain points or areas of dissatisfaction.

Crafting How: Developing Effective Strategies and Tactics

Finally, the how encompasses the specific strategies and tactics you will employ to achieve your goals. This involves defining your marketing mix, creating a content strategy, and implementing operational processes.

  • Develop a strong brand identity: Establish a clear and consistent brand message, logo, and visual identity that resonates with your target audience.
  • Create valuable content: Provide informative and engaging content that meets the needs and interests of your audience, building trust and establishing yourself as an expert.
  • Optimize your website: Ensure your website is user-friendly, responsive, and optimized for search engines (SEO) to increase visibility and engagement.

Common Mistakes to Avoid

1. Lack of Focus: Spreading your efforts too thin by targeting multiple audiences or pursuing too many goals simultaneously.

2. Inconsistent Messaging: Failing to maintain a consistent brand message and tone across all marketing channels.

3. Neglecting Data Analysis: Not collecting or analyzing customer data to understand their motivations and behaviors.

4. Ignoring Geographic Expansion: Limiting your growth to a single geographic location without exploring potential opportunities in new markets.

5. Underestimating the Importance of Content: Creating low-quality or irrelevant content that fails to engage your audience or provide value.
